Effect of the Entorhinal Cortex on Ictal Discharges in Low-Mg2+-Induced Epileptic Hippocampal Slice Models
The hippocampus plays an important role in the genesis of mesial temporal lobe epilepsy, and the entorhinal cortex (EC) may affect the hippocampal network activity because of the heavy interconnection between them.
